https://eprnews.com/ Inspirus Credit Union and Gesa Credit Union Announce Merger Approvals Press Release (ePRNews.com) - RICHLAND, Wash. - Aug 02, 2019 - Inspirus Credit Union and Gesa Credit Union have announced their merger has received regulatory approval, as well as approval by a majority vote of the Inspirus Credit Union membership. The two organizations plan to be officially merged on August 1, 2019. On the official merger date, Inspirus Credit Union will become a division of Gesa Credit Union. Both organizations will continue to serve members “business as usual” at their combined 24 branch locations as they work to fully integrate their systems in late 2020. Gesa Credit Union President and CEO Don Miller will be the CEO of the combined organization on the legal merger effective date, and executive management from both credit unions will make up the senior leadership team of the new organization. Inspirus Credit Union President and CEO Scott Adkins will be an Executive Vice President in the combined organization. All current Inspirus Credit Union and Gesa Credit Union Board members will serve on the combined credit union’s Board of Directors. The name for the combined organization has not yet been determined. Inspirus and Gesa are proud of their individual brands but recognize it may not serve the purposes of a newly created, statewide credit union. The merged organizations will conduct a comprehensive brand research study to determine the most appropriate and unifying name for the combined organization.
